I’m not a professional or expert -
My husband, son and I live in the northern suburbs of Melbourne.
My son is anaphylactic to nuts and is also now dairy intolerant so I initially made his birthday cakes so that I knew what ingredients were in them.
His first birthday cake in 2007 was a number 1 with blue buttercream icing and butterflies made from chocolate freckles.
Each birthday I challenged myself and found it to be a very satisfying creative outlet. Then family members, friends and work colleagues asked me to make cakes for them -
I started this website to showcase my cakes and provide information I have learnt along the way that may help you in your hobby of cake decorating.
